Koep Concerts – Coeur d’Alene
Every summer Wednesday, Michael Koep hosts Music at McEuen (affectionately known as M’am) as a part of CDA’s KOEP Concerts in the park music series. Wednesday nights at McEuen Park explode with musical fusion in a FREE outdoor concert series, bringing everything from funk to country to the heart of downtown CDA.
Note: Music at McEuen is just one of three venues for KOEP Concerts, the music festival also includes The Rotary Bandshell at CDA City Park on Sundays, and music Thursday nights at McIntire Family Park in Hayden, Idaho.
Best For: Midweek energy boost
Bonus: It’s family-friendly and has food trucks!
The Hive – Sandpoint
A go-to venue for both local and touring acts, The Hive has made a name for itself with high-energy shows and great sound. Located in downtown Sandpoint, it’s known for its concert-style setup and rotating calendar of national performers.
Best For: Full-band concerts, weekend nightlife

The Coeur d’Alene Resort and Bands on Boats
Summer in Coeur d’Alene means one thing — live music with a view. The Resort hosts several music series, including Bands on boats, where local musicians play lakeside on floating stages.
Best For: Summer sunsets + acoustic sets
Vibe: Relaxed, family-friendly
MickDuff’s Beer Hall – Sandpoint
Part brewery, part hangout, MickDuff’s Beer Hall frequently hosts live music on weekends. Expect a mix of solo artists, cover bands, and bluegrass ensembles in a casual, beer-forward atmosphere.
Best For: Local flavor, relaxed nights
Pro Tip: Grab a seat early—the place fills up quick
Schweitzer Mountain Resort – Sandpoint
Yes, in the winter one can ski/board and catch a show. Schweitzer hosts music festivals, après-ski jams, but they also host summer concerts on the mountain. The scenery is unbeatable, and each lineup always packs the house.
Best For: Outdoor music with a mountain backdrop
Seasonal Highlight: Fall Fest – a multi-day music and beer festival
The Crown & Thistle – Coeur d’Alene
This British-style pub mixes old-world charm with live acoustic sets, usually in the evenings. Think Celtic vibes, singer-songwriters, and the occasional folk band.
Best For: Cozy vibes and intimate sets
What to Try: Their rotating list of regional wines and ales
